1. Quiksilver

Quiksilver is one of the most recognized names in surf clothing and gear. Founded in 1969, this brand has been synonymous with surf culture. Quiksilver offers a wide range of products, from boardshorts to wetsuits, ensuring that you stay comfortable in and out of the water. Their designs often feature vibrant colors and bold patterns, appealing to both young surfers and seasoned pros.

2. Billabong

Another iconic surf clothing brand is Billabong. Established in Australia in 1973, Billabong is known for its high-quality surfwear that balances style and durability. Their collections include everything from swimwear to jackets, catering to surfers who need reliable gear. The brand emphasizes sustainability, creating eco-friendly products made from recycled materials, which resonates with environmentally conscious consumers.

3. Rip Curl

Rip Curl was founded in 1969 and has earned its place among the best surf clothing brands by focusing on innovation and quality. Known for their high-performance wetsuits and surf accessories, Rip Curl also produces stylish apparel suited for casual wear. They are committed to designing gear that enhances the surfing experience, making them a favorite among serious surfers worldwide.

4. O'Neill

O'Neill is a pioneer in surf clothing, with a history dating back to 1952. The brand revolutionized wetsuit design, ensuring surfers could ride comfortably in colder waters. O’Neill's commitment to quality and performance makes it a trusted choice for surfers everywhere. Beyond wetsuits, O'Neill also offers a wide range of surf-inspired clothing that combines style and functionality.

5. Vans

Although Vans is primarily known for its skateboarding heritage, the brand has made significant inroads into surf culture. With a variety of shoes, apparel, and accessories, Vans caters to the laid-back lifestyle of surfers. Their iconic slip-on sneakers and graphic tees have become staples on the beach, showcasing the crossover between skating and surfing.

6. Hurley

Founded in 1999, Hurley quickly gained popularity in the surf community. The brand is known for its innovative technology in boardshorts and performance apparel, which enhances the surfing experience. Hurley's roots in music and art also influence its design philosophy, creating vibrant and expressive clothing that appeals to a dynamic audience. The brand’s commitment to youth culture and lifestyle aligns perfectly with the surfing ethos.

7. Patagonia

While not exclusively a surf brand, Patagonia has made significant contributions to surf culture, particularly through its commitment to environmental activism. The company produces high-quality surfwear made from sustainable materials, including recycled polyester made from plastic bottles. Their surf-specific products, like wetsuits and boardshorts, reflect their dedication to performance while promoting a love for the ocean and nature.

8. Roxy

Roxy is the female counterpart of Quiksilver and focuses on surf apparel and accessories for women. The brand has carved out a niche by offering fashionable and functional surfwear. From swimsuits to casual dresses, Roxy combines style with practicality, making it a top choice for female surfers. Their products not only perform well in the water but also transition seamlessly to beachside lounging.

9. 686

686 originated as a snowboarding brand, but it has embraced the surf culture as well. Known for its innovative fabric technologies, 686 creates versatile clothing that works equally well for winter sports and summer surfing. Their stylish yet functional apparel is perfect for surfers looking for gear that performs well in various conditions.

10. Local Surf Shops

While big-name brands dominate the surf clothing market, local surf shops often carry unique and high-quality surf apparel that reflects regional styles and culture. These shops support local artisans and often provide handmade or limited-edition items that can’t be found in chain stores. Shopping at local surf shops not only helps the community but also allows surfers to connect with the culture in a deeper way.
